Circumference vs. Girth: Key Differences Explained

As we continue our exploration, let’s dive into the intriguing distinctions between circumference and girth. While both terms involve measurements around an object, they serve different purposes. Girth measurements provide valuable insights into body changes and sizes over time by measuring at standard anatomical sites. On the other hand, circumference refers to the length around an object’s outer edge or trunk, as with trees. It’s like comparing a tailor taking your waist girth measurement with wrapping a tape measure around a tree trunk to determine its circumference.

Girth is all about that snug hug around an object, capturing its width or thickness in all its glory – whether it’s measuring the waist of a person or the trunk of a majestic tree. Now, let’s clear up a common misconception: while girth typically measures around something circular or cylindrical to capture its fullness, diameter, on the other hand, is straight through the middle of a circle or sphere. It’s like distinguishing between hugging someone from all sides versus drawing a straight line right through them without touching their sides.

When it comes to measuring girth circumference practically – picture yourself as a human tape measure! Wrap that tape snugly around your waist (or someone else’s if you’re feeling adventurous) to get an accurate girth measurement. As for trees, foresters have been using tree girth measurements for eons as one of the quickest and simplest ways to track growth and size – it’s like giving those leafy giants an annual check-up!

So remember, next time you’re pondering girth versus circumference: think of girth as encircling something for a full-body hug while envisioning circumference as walking along the outer edge of that round figure. Keep in mind these distinctions when considering which measurement best suits your sizing needs – whether you’re tailoring clothes for humans or tracking tree growth in the great outdoors!

How do I calculate circumference?

The circumference of a circle can be found using the formula C = πd, where d is the diameter of the circle.

What is the difference between length and girth?

Length is the longest dimension measured in inches, while girth is the distance around the thickest part of the remaining non-length sides, also measured in inches.
